2019 Cannes contenders: 'The Soap with a Lump' by Wunderman Thompson India

Lux redesigns an age-old product to remind women to check their breasts for lumps in the shower, when they feel most comfortable doing so.

Contender: The Soap with a Lump
Agency: Wunderman Thompson India
Client: Lux

Nominated by:

Merlee Jayme, chairmom/chief creative officer, Dentsu Jayme Syfu:

It looked weird at first. Then, it dawned on me that it actually made sense. Since we were young, we were always taught to examine our own breasts. But we were quite unsure what we were supposed to look for or “feel for”. The Lux soap is a simple tactile solution to self-examination in the best time to do it-in the shower.
